About

United Rentals is a Stamford, Connecticut-based equipment rental company — publicly traded on the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E: URI) as an S&P 500 component — operating as the world's largest equipment rental company with approximately 16% of the North American market, a fleet of 4,800+ classes of equipment valued at $20.59 billion in original equipment cost, and 1,625 locations across North America, Europe, Australia, and New Zealand. In fiscal 2024, United Rentals generated $15.3 billion in revenue (record) with 22,397 employees, and Q4 2024 revenue of $4.095 billion (record), with the Board approving a 10% quarterly dividend increase. The specialty rental segment (trench safety, power & HVAC, pump solutions) generates $4+ billion annually as the fastest-growing segment. CEO Matthew Flannery has led the company since 2019. United Rentals was founded in 1997 by Brad Jacobs through an acquisition-led consolidation strategy, completing ~275 acquisitions including RSC Holdings ($4.2B, 2012), BlueLine Rental ($2.1B, 2018), and Ahern Rentals ($2.0B, 2022).

About

Veeam is a backup, disaster recovery, and data management platform that protects workloads running in VMware, Hyper-V, physical server, cloud, and SaaS environments from a single management console, making it one of the most widely deployed data protection solutions for hybrid infrastructure. The platform's reputation was built on its VM-level backup capabilities for VMware vSphere, providing agentless backup with application-aware processing for SQL Server, Oracle, Exchange, and other workloads, instant VM recovery that restores a failed virtual machine in minutes directly from backup storage, and granular recovery of individual files, application items, and database objects without restoring the entire VM image. These capabilities addressed gaps in legacy tape and agent-based backup tools that could not keep pace with the density and recovery time requirements of virtualized data centers.
